The Unmatched Bond Between Humans and Pets
The connection between humans and pets is unique and deeply rooted in mutual affection and trust. Whether it’s a dog greeting you with a wagging tail or a cat curling up in your lap, these interactions foster a sense of belonging and emotional well-being. Studies have shown that pet ownership can reduce stress, lower blood pressure, and even decrease the risk of heart disease. The daily routines, shared experiences, and unconditional love create a bond that is both comforting and enduring.
Life Lessons Taught by Pets
Our pets teach us invaluable life lessons. Their ability to live in the moment reminds us to appreciate the present. They teach responsibility through daily care routines and empathy by responding to our emotions. Observing a pet’s resilience in the face of illness or adversity can inspire us to face our own challenges with courage and grace.
The Inevitable Goodbye: Coping with Pet Loss
Saying goodbye to a beloved pet is one of the most challenging aspects of pet ownership. The grief experienced can be as intense as losing a human family member. It’s essential to acknowledge this grief and seek support when needed. Creating a memorial, talking to friends or support groups, and allowing oneself to mourn are crucial steps in the healing process.

Honoring the Memory of a Beloved Pet
Memorializing a pet can provide comfort and a sense of closure. Options include creating a photo album, planting a tree, or keeping a special item that belonged to the pet.
